In 1937 the United States imposed an arms embargo for this purpose on both sides in the Spanish Civil War, and in 1991 the United Nations attempted to halt the fighting in the former Yugoslavia by imposing an arms embargo against all the belligerents. An embargo may also be imposed to prevent potentially threatening countries from increasing their military power.

OPEC enacts oil embargo. The Arab-dominated Organization of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) announces a decision to cut oil exports to the United States and other nations that provided military aid to Israel in the Yom Kippur War of October 1973.

5 Jun 2017 The “oil weapon” largely failed in 1967, and was most harmful to the oil producing countries that gave up substantial revenue during the embargo. The oil embargo gave OPEC new power to achieve its goal of managing the world's oil supply and keeping prices stable. By raising and lowering supply, OPEC tries to stabilize the price of oil. If the price drops too low, they would be selling their finite commodity too cheap.
